Trump Orders Navy to ‘Shoot and Kill’ Boats Laying Mines in Strait of Hormuz

- Advertisement -

US President Donald Trump has announced a significant increase in military operations along the Strait of Hormuz. He directed the US Navy to target all vessels, regardless of size, with no hesitation. According to Trump, 159 enemy naval vessels have already been sunk, while minesweepers work on clearing the waterway.

Trump also stated that any boat involved in laying mines would be destroyed without hesitation. However, he emphasized there is currently no fixed timeline for extending the ceasefire with Iran. The White House Press Secretary, Karoline Leavitt, dismissed reports suggesting a three-to-five-day extension as incorrect and noted that President Trump has set no deadline.
